The Historic Roots of Mexican Cuisine



Although Mexican food is commonly celebrated for its dynamic flavors and varied components, its historic roots run deep, showing a rich tapestry of cultural impacts. Stemming from ancient Mesoamerican worlds, such as the Aztecs and Mayans, Mexican food progressed through centuries of agricultural techniques that incorporated neighborhood crops like maize, beans, and chili peppers. The arrival of Spanish colonizers in the 16th century presented brand-new components, consisting of rice, pork, and dairy, which integrated native practices to create distinct cooking fusions. This blend of affects not only shaped the recipes however also represented the social and social characteristics of the time. Throughout the years, local variants arised, influenced by geography, climate, and neighborhood customizeds. Consequently, Mexican cuisine stands as a reflection of its historic trip, embodying the strength and adaptability of its individuals while commemorating their heritage with food.

Special Active Ingredients by Region



Mexican cuisine showcases an amazing array of special components that vary substantially across its varied regions, each adding culinary techniques and distinct tastes. In the coastal areas, seafood such as shrimp and fish are staples, often combined with exotic fruits like mango and coconut. The central highlands are recognized for their rich range of beans, corn, and squash, forming the basis of lots of traditional recipes. In the Yucatán Peninsula, achiote and sour oranges impart a special flavor profile, while the north areas favor beef and wheat-based recipes, reflecting the impact of neighboring societies. Each region's climate and location shape the regional active ingredients, producing a vivid tapestry of flavors that highlight Mexico's abundant cooking heritage.

Typical Food Preparation Techniques



The diverse active ingredients found throughout Mexico not just form the meals yet additionally affect the typical cooking techniques utilized in each area. In Oaxaca, the use of a rock mortar and pestle, known as a "metate," is widespread for grinding corn and seasonings to produce masa and mole. In contrast, seaside areas frequently use grilling and steaming approaches to prepare seafood, reflecting their accessibility to fresh catch. The highlands may emphasize slow-cooking approaches, such as barbacoa, where meats are wrapped in maguey leaves and hidden in the ground. Each strategy is deeply rooted in the regional culture, showcasing the importance of tradition while boosting the unique flavors that identify Mexican cuisine across varied landscapes.

Old Methods Maintaining Heritage



While contemporary culinary strategies have actually transformed the landscape of Mexican food, ancient methods continue to be a crucial web link to the country's abundant heritage. Methods such as nixtamalization, the procedure of dealing with corn with lime to improve its nutritional worth, have actually been essential in forming traditional dishes. The use of clay pots and rock mortars, called molcajetes, also shows the emphasis on credibility and flavor that has actually been given with generations. These approaches not only maintain the integrity of active ingredients but likewise personify common worths and social practices. By remaining to use these imp source ancient methods, modern Mexican chefs maintain a connection to their forefathers, guaranteeing that the cooking arts remain lively and reflective of the nation's varied history.

Celebrations and Festivities: Food as a Social Expression



Events and festivities in Mexico are commonly noted by a variety of dynamic meals that reflect the country's abundant social heritage. Typical dishes, such as tamales during Día de los Muertos and pozole during Freedom Day, display regional ingredients and cooking methods, representing area and domestic bonds. Food comes to be a tool for narration, with each recipe lugging historical importance and regional identifications.


Along with the meals themselves, the rituals surrounding food preparation and usage play a crucial duty in these parties. Family members collect to produce sophisticated dishes, cultivating links and protecting practices passed down with generations. The common nature of these culinary techniques highlights the relevance of sharing food as an expression of love and unity. Through these festive celebrations, Mexican cuisine goes beyond mere nutrients, working as a cultural symbol that commemorates heritage, spirituality, and the happiness of togetherness.
